Delegates will be able to: Give emergency First Aid to an injured person until medical assistance arrives. Recognise and appropriately treat basic emergency situations. Carry out the duties of an Appointed Person as specified within the First Aid Regulations. Suitable for low/medium risk establishments or to compliment your existing provision. For low risk environments where there is no requirement for a First Aid at Work trained first aider. However, even if a First Aider is not legally required, an employer must still appoint a person to take charge of first aid provision. For employers who wish to provide the highest standard of first aid care to employees, contractors and the public. It is also ideal for individuals and lone workers and is often the minimum requirement for sports coaches, instructors and support workers.

A course which qualifies you as the Appointed Person to take charge when someone is injured or falls ill at work.

What you will learn?
This certificate provides delegates with basic theoretical and practical skills in current first aid.

The emergency aid aspect of the course is designed to equip delegates with essential life saving skills.

Course Content:

  • Aims and principles of first aid.
  • What to do in an emergency.
  • Casualty Assessment.
  • Unconsciousness.
  • Asphyxia - care of a choking casualty.
  • CPR.
  • Wounds and Bleeding.
  • Assessment and treatment of burns and scalds.
  • Dressings.
  • Maintaining first aid kits.
  • Maintaining accident records.

Assessment
There is no formal assessment as this is not required by the HSE.

Successful completion of the course qualifies the holder to act as an 'Appointed Person' in the workplace. The certificate is valid for three years from the date of issue.

Costs are per delegate and include a personal reference manual & certification fees.
